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
052998245 0416829 1563 257413051 126529
34959 889673820
34959 889673820
4018792 46 2732
All about undefined
Interested in learning more?
34959 889673820
4018792 46 2732
See more
175350 81677430893
8110 30825587 146477911 17189 37980342088
See more
8881467 0583463214
377 67 89
See more